Highlights
Are people in La Mesa older or younger than people in Highland?
- The Median Age in La Mesa is 10.9 years younger than in Highland.

Are housing costs cheaper in La Mesa or Highland?
- La Mesa housing costs are 62.9% more expensive than Highland hous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, La Mesa or Highland?
- The average commute for residents of La Mesa is 3.3 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Highland.
